In the 2011-2012 period, there were a handful of new producers who came up and soon took over the game. On the West Coast, it was DJ Mustard who brought a different sound to the industry. While he worked more with YG, DJ Mustard’s first hit was with Tyga.
DJ Mustard produced “Rack City” for Tyga and it led to him enjoying a four year run of success. Soon, DJ Mustard found himself recruited by Jay Z, signing with Roc Nation. During the same time he signed with Jay Z, DJ Mustard and YG finally had success.
This afternoon, DJ Mustard released 10 Summers: The Mixtape and he stopped by Big Boy at Real 92.3. When he came in, DJ Mustard talked about his new project and he also spoke on working with Britney Spears. He also told a hilarious story about running into his mother while he was in the strip club.
